I am SO EXCITED to be finally getting round to picking up Dragonfall! I’ve been a fan of Lam’s writing for a while now, but this sounds like it going to be extra swoony and has Dragons!! Scarlet definitely has be intrigued because I have no idea what it’s going to be like, but it has the French Revolution and Vampires so I’m in. The Curse of Saints is a romantasy that has some raving reviews out atm, so I’m excited to give it a read.



I’m so happy De Castell is back writing adult fantasy, because his Greatcoats series is an all time favourite of mine, so I am obviously excited to start The Malevolent Seven. T.J. Klune knows how to break me as a reader, so I’m excited but also wary to start In the Lives of Puppets. A book about books, set in a library, by an author I’ve been meaning to read for years… yes please. The Book that Wouldn’t Burn sounds amazing.




Susan and I are going to be buddy reading The Last Heir to Blackwood Library. We read a book by Fox last year and loved it, so are hoping we will enjoy this one just as much. Leah, Susan and I have tentatively said we will be buddy reading Vicious next month as well, it’s one of the few Schwab books I haven’t read and I’ve been meaning to pick it up for a while. Leah and I are also going to be buddy reading Hell Bent. I meant to get to this when it was released, but I’m excited to be buddy reading it with Leah.
